Lacres is a French municipality with 247 inhabitants (as of January 1 2017) in the department of Pas-de-Calais in the region of Hauts-de-France (before 2016: Nord-Pas-de-Calais ). It belongs to the arrondissement of Boulogne-sur-Mer and the canton Desvres (until 2015: canton Samer ). The inhabitants are called Isquois .

geography

Lacres is located about 17 kilometers south-southeast of Boulogne-sur-Mer . The municipality is part of the Caps et Marais d'Opale Regional Nature Park .

Lacres is surrounded by the neighboring communities of Samer in the north, Doudeauville in the northeast, Parenty in the east, Hubersent in the south and southwest and Tingry in the west and northwest.

Attractions

Saint Martin Church
  • Saint-Martin church from the 15th century
  • 17th century manor house
  • British military cemetery
